php結合html怎麼實現驗證碼,這可能是很多人想知道的,尤其是php初學者。其實想要實現驗證碼的方式有很多種,但是對於初學者來說,有得可能過於複雜不適合新手。這裡提供一個很簡易的,僅供初學者試玩,不要覺得瞧不起,再複雜的技術也是從一些簡單的代碼延伸出來的。
1、首先新建一個php文件,輸入html基本模板,然後將下面這段php代碼插入body里:

這段代碼首先聲明了編碼格式UTF-8,其次定義了一個空字元,接著通過字元串連接功能和mt_rand()隨機函數,生成四個顏色隨機的隨機數。
2、接下來就要寫html代碼

這裡要說一下:做一個隱藏的div保存生成的驗證碼,後面可以用來跟用戶輸入的進行比對。
3、js驗證

點擊提交按鈕,獲取到隱藏div里的文本值和輸入框的值,進行比較,判斷值是否一致,從而判斷驗證成功與否。

當然這只是給新手練手,提供一個思路用的
原創文章,作者:投稿專員,如若轉載,請註明出處:https://www.506064.com/zh-tw/n/281316.html
微信掃一掃
支付寶掃一掃